Image Firefox,svg图像渲染错误

Image Firefox,svg图像渲染错误,image,firefox,svg,render,Image,Firefox,Svg,Render,我在Ubuntu上用Firefox渲染SVG图像时遇到问题。您可以在所附图像上看到字母J下面有一条小黑线。此伪影仅在某些缩放级别发生。图像添加了 编辑:由于这只影响边框上的图像,我发现了一种解决方法,可以在文本编辑器中打开SVG,增加两个像素的高度和宽度,这意味着在文本周围留下一点透明的填充 我仍然很好奇这是否是firefox的bug,尽管原则上,SVG在firefox中的表现并不比在其他浏览器中差。但每种浏览器在渲染方面都有自己的不足之处,尤其是当形状彼此接近且缩放开始发挥作用时 因此,我可能

我在Ubuntu上用Firefox渲染SVG图像时遇到问题。您可以在所附图像上看到字母J下面有一条小黑线。此伪影仅在某些缩放级别发生。图像添加了

编辑:由于这只影响边框上的图像,我发现了一种解决方法,可以在文本编辑器中打开SVG,增加两个像素的高度和宽度,这意味着在文本周围留下一点透明的填充


我仍然很好奇这是否是firefox的bug,尽管原则上,SVG在firefox中的表现并不比在其他浏览器中差。但每种浏览器在渲染方面都有自己的不足之处,尤其是当形状彼此接近且缩放开始发挥作用时

因此,我可能建议查看您的图形,并在字母周围留出一点空间,这样就不会有形状直接与字母轮廓对齐。不幸的是,我看不到您图形的代码,但我非常确定问题是由彼此非常接近的形状(按»捕捉«排列)引起的,并且没有»保存重叠«

对于字体,有暗示,是什么优化了呈现,特别是对于小尺寸,但对于SVG,没有暗示,因为您无法确定每个浏览器将如何处理这些»边缘情况»,所以由您来准备图形,以便这些故障不会出现